交换机和路由器
在计算机网络领域中,交换机和路由器是两个常见的网络设备。
虽然它们都具有相似的功能,即在网络中传输数据,但它们在工作原理和应用场景上存在着不同。
首先,交换机主要在局域网(LAN)中使用。
它通过学习和过滤MAC(Media Access Control)地址来转发数据包。
当数据包到达交换机时,交换机会根据包头中的MAC地址,将数据包转发给目标MAC地址对应的设备。
这种转发方式可以提高局域网内部的数据传输效率,从而减少网络拥堵。
相比之下,路由器则更适用于广域网(WAN)和局域网之间的连接。
它使用IP(Internet Protocol)地址来转发数据包。
当数据包到达路由器时,路由器会根据目标IP地址,通过查找路由表来确定最佳路径,并将数据包转发给下一个路由器或目标设备。
由于路由器具有路由选择的功能,它能够实现不同网络之间的连接与通信。
此外,交换机和路由器还有一些其他的区别。
交换机工作在数据链路层(第二层),而路由器工作在网络层(第三层)。
交换机通常有较多的端口,可连接多个设备,并支持同一时间的全双工通信。
而路由器则通常只有几个端口,并可以连接到不同的网络。
由于交换机和路由器的差异,它们在网络架构、性能要求和安全策略等方面的应用也不同。
总之,交换机和路由器在计算机网络中扮演着不同的角色。
交换机主要用于构建局域网,提供高效的内部数据传输;而路由器主要用于连接不同的网络,实现网络间的通信。
了解它们的区别和应用场景,有助于我们在网络设计和维护时做出合理的选择与决策。